Skip to main content

Who Should I Trade?

Dylan Moore for Lourdes Gurriel Jr. (2024)


See if your team wins or loses with this trade View Trade Analyzer

Who Should I Trade? Player Summaries
 
Experts' Pick
 
  Lourdes Gurriel Jr.
LF,DH - ARI
Lourdes Gurriel Jr.
Dylan Moore
2B,CI,LF,SS - SEA
Dylan Moore
Expert
Recommendation
100%
Recommended by
8 of 8 experts
0%
Recommended by
0 of 8 experts
Rankings 
   
Rest of Season# 113
VBR# 103# 1168
   
Projections 
   
Runs6026
Home Runs167
RBI6721
Stolen Bases512
Batting Average.280.215
   
Misc 
   
Injury Alert--
   
Expert Ranks 
   
Andy Behrens
Yahoo! Sports
# 124
   
Scott Pianowski
Yahoo! Sports
# 113
   
Pat Fitzmaurice
FantasyPros
# 109
   
Dalton Del Don
Yahoo! Sports
# 117
   
Christopher Welsh
FantasyPros
# 84
   
Mike Maher
FantasyPros
# 124# 380
   
Joe Pisapia
FantasyPros
# 103
   
Kelly Kirby
FantasyPros
# 127
   
Who Should I Trade? Player Statistics
  Lourdes Gurriel Jr.
LF,DH - ARI
Lourdes Gurriel Jr.
Dylan Moore
2B,CI,LF,SS - SEA
Dylan Moore
2024 Stats 
   
   
At Bats7633
   
Runs145
   
Hits206
   
Singles123
   
Doubles31
   
Triples01
   
Home Runs51
   
RBI202
   
Stolen Bases23
   
Caught Stealing01
   
Walks85
   
Strikeouts1210
   
Batting Average.263.182
   
On Base Pct.333.325
   
Slugging Pct.500.364
   
On-base Plus Slugging.833.689
   
Who Should I Trade? Player Projections
  Lourdes Gurriel Jr.
LF,DH - ARI
Lourdes Gurriel Jr.
Dylan Moore
2B,CI,LF,SS - SEA
Dylan Moore
2024 Projections 
   
   
At Bats453176
   
Runs6026
   
Hits12738
   
Singles8121
   
Doubles279
   
Triples21
   
Home Runs167
   
RBI6721
   
Stolen Bases512
   
Caught Stealing24
   
Walks3221
   
Strikeouts8761
   
Batting Average.280.215
   
On Base Pct.332.314
   
Slugging Pct.456.394
   
On-base Plus Slugging.787.708
   
Who Should I Trade? Player Notes
  Lourdes Gurriel Jr.
LF,DH - ARI
Lourdes Gurriel Jr.
Dylan Moore
2B,CI,LF,SS - SEA
Dylan Moore
News 
 Lourdes Gurriel Jr. went 2-for-4 with a home run and three RBI in the Diamondbacks' 4-2 victory over the Cardinals.
Chris Schommer
Sun, Apr 14th
Dylan Moore returns to the lineup for the Seattle Mariners against the Milwaukee Brewers Saturday.
Chris Schommer
Sat, Apr 6th
 Lourdes Gurriel Jr. is back in the Diamondbacks lineup on Wednesday against the Rockies.
Ari Koslow
Wed, Apr 10th
Dylan Moore went 0-for-2 with one strikeout as a pinch-hitter in Sunday's 5-1 loss against the Red Sox.
Ari Koslow
Mon, Apr 1st
 Lourdes Gurriel Jr. is missing from the lineup for the Arizona Diamondbacks against the Colorado Rockies Tuesday.
Chris Schommer
Tue, Apr 9th
 
Notes 
There are no recent notes for these players
Who Should I Trade? Player Schedules
  Lourdes Gurriel Jr.
LF,DH - ARI
Lourdes Gurriel Jr.
Dylan Moore
2B,CI,LF,SS - SEA
Dylan Moore
Date OppOpp PitcherVBROppOpp PitcherVBR
Thu, Mar 28thvs COLKyle Freeland (0-3)#415vs BOSBrayan Bello (2-1)#82
Fri, Mar 29thvs COLCal Quantrill (0-2)#416vs BOSNick Pivetta (1-1)#75
Sat, Mar 30thvs COLAustin Gomber (0-1)#413vs BOSKutter Crawford (0-0)#83
Sun, Mar 31stvs COLRyan Feltner (1-2)#330vs BOSGarrett Whitlock (1-0)#76
Mon, Apr 1stvs NYYLuis Gil (0-1)#112vs CLETriston McKenzie (1-2)#87
Tue, Apr 2ndvs NYYNestor Cortes Jr. (1-1)#41vs CLEShane Bieber (2-0)
Wed, Apr 3rdvs NYYCarlos Rodon (1-1)#23vs CLELogan Allen (2-0)#89
Fri, Apr 5th@ ATLSpencer Strider (0-0)@ MILFreddy Peralta (2-0)#14
Sat, Apr 6th@ ATLMax Fried (1-0)#11@ MILDL Hall (0-1)#104
Sun, Apr 7th@ ATLChris Sale (1-1)#20@ MILColin Rea (2-0)#136
Mon, Apr 8th@ COLKyle Freeland (0-3)#415@ TORJose Berrios (3-0)#35
Tue, Apr 9th@ COLCal Quantrill (0-2)#416@ TORChris Bassitt (2-2)#28
Wed, Apr 10th@ COLAustin Gomber (0-1)#413@ TORYusei Kikuchi (1-1)#50
Fri, Apr 12thvs STLSteven Matz (1-1)#72vs CHCJordan Wicks (0-2)#117
Sat, Apr 13thvs STLKyle Gibson (1-2)#129vs CHCShota Imanaga (2-0)#26
Sun, Apr 14thvs STLMiles Mikolas (1-2)#91vs CHCJavier Assad (2-0)#169
Mon, Apr 15thvs CHCBen Brown (0-0)#155vs CINFrankie Montas (2-2)#119
Tue, Apr 16thvs CHCKyle Hendricks (0-2)#163vs CINHunter Greene (0-1)#43
Wed, Apr 17thvs CHCJordan Wicks (0-2)#117vs CINAndrew Abbott (1-2)#110
Fri, Apr 19th@ SFBlake Snell (0-2)#24@ COLDakota Hudson (0-3)#417
Sat, Apr 20th@ SFKyle Harrison (2-1)#96@ COLKyle Freeland (0-3)#415
Sun, Apr 21st@ SFJordan Hicks (2-0)#86@ COLCal Quantrill (0-2)#416
Tue, Apr 23rd@ STLSteven Matz (1-1)#72@ TEXDane Dunning (2-1)#133
Wed, Apr 24th@ STLKyle Gibson (1-2)#129@ TEX
Thu, Apr 25th   @ TEXJack Leiter#348
Fri, Apr 26th@ SEALuis Castillo (0-4)#5vs ARIZac Gallen (3-0)#12
Sat, Apr 27th@ SEAGeorge Kirby (2-2)#8vs ARIMerrill Kelly (2-0)#31
Sun, Apr 28th@ SEALogan Gilbert (1-0)#17vs ARIBrandon Pfaadt (1-1)#62
Mon, Apr 29thvs LADvs ATL
Tue, Apr 30thvs LADvs ATL
Wed, May 1stvs LADvs ATL
Fri, May 3rdvs SD@ HOU
Sat, May 4thvs SD@ HOU
Sun, May 5thvs SD@ HOU
Mon, May 6th   @ MIN
Tue, May 7th@ CIN@ MIN
Wed, May 8th@ CIN@ MIN
Thu, May 9th@ CIN@ MIN
Fri, May 10th@ BALvs OAK
Sat, May 11th@ BALvs OAK
Sun, May 12th@ BALvs OAK
Mon, May 13thvs CINvs KC
Tue, May 14thvs CINvs KC
Wed, May 15thvs CINvs KC
Fri, May 17thvs DET@ BAL
Sat, May 18thvs DET@ BAL
Sun, May 19thvs DET@ BAL
Mon, May 20th@ LAD@ NYY
Tue, May 21st@ LAD@ NYY
Wed, May 22nd@ LAD@ NYY
Thu, May 23rd   @ NYY
Fri, May 24thvs MIA@ WSH
Sat, May 25thvs MIA@ WSH
Sun, May 26thvs MIA@ WSH
Mon, May 27th   vs HOU
Tue, May 28th@ TEXvs HOU
Wed, May 29th@ TEXvs HOU
Thu, May 30th@ NYMvs HOU
Fri, May 31st@ NYMvs LAA
Sat, Jun 1st@ NYMvs LAA
Sun, Jun 2nd@ NYMvs LAA
Tue, Jun 4thvs SF@ OAK
Wed, Jun 5thvs SF@ OAK
Thu, Jun 6th@ SD@ OAK
Fri, Jun 7th@ SD@ KC
Sat, Jun 8th@ SD@ KC
Sun, Jun 9th@ SD@ KC
Mon, Jun 10th   vs CWS
Tue, Jun 11thvs LAAvs CWS
Wed, Jun 12thvs LAAvs CWS
Thu, Jun 13thvs LAAvs CWS
Fri, Jun 14thvs CWSvs TEX
Sat, Jun 15thvs CWSvs TEX
Sun, Jun 16thvs CWSvs TEX
Tue, Jun 18th@ WSH@ CLE
Wed, Jun 19th@ WSH@ CLE
Thu, Jun 20th@ WSH@ CLE
Fri, Jun 21st@ PHI@ MIA
Sat, Jun 22nd@ PHI@ MIA
Sun, Jun 23rd@ PHI@ MIA
Mon, Jun 24th   @ TB
Tue, Jun 25thvs MIN@ TB
Wed, Jun 26thvs MIN@ TB
Fri, Jun 28thvs OAKvs MIN
Sat, Jun 29thvs OAKvs MIN
Sun, Jun 30thvs OAKvs MIN
Tue, Jul 2nd@ LADvs BAL
Wed, Jul 3rd@ LADvs BAL
Thu, Jul 4th@ LADvs BAL
Fri, Jul 5th@ SDvs TOR
Sat, Jul 6th@ SDvs TOR
Sun, Jul 7th@ SDvs TOR
Tue, Jul 9thvs ATL@ SD
Wed, Jul 10thvs ATL@ SD
Thu, Jul 11thvs ATL@ LAA
Fri, Jul 12thvs TOR@ LAA
Sat, Jul 13thvs TOR@ LAA
Sun, Jul 14thvs TOR@ LAA
Fri, Jul 19th@ CHCvs HOU
Sat, Jul 20th@ CHCvs HOU
Sun, Jul 21st@ CHCvs HOU
Mon, Jul 22nd@ KCvs LAA
Tue, Jul 23rd@ KCvs LAA
Wed, Jul 24th@ KCvs LAA
Fri, Jul 26thvs PIT@ CWS
Sat, Jul 27thvs PIT@ CWS
Sun, Jul 28thvs PIT@ CWS
Mon, Jul 29thvs WSH@ BOS
Tue, Jul 30thvs WSH@ BOS
Wed, Jul 31stvs WSH@ BOS
Fri, Aug 2nd@ PITvs PHI
Sat, Aug 3rd@ PITvs PHI
Sun, Aug 4th@ PITvs PHI
Tue, Aug 6th@ CLEvs DET
Wed, Aug 7th@ CLEvs DET
Thu, Aug 8thvs PHIvs DET
Fri, Aug 9thvs PHIvs NYM
Sat, Aug 10thvs PHIvs NYM
Sun, Aug 11thvs PHIvs NYM
Tue, Aug 13thvs COL@ DET
Wed, Aug 14thvs COL@ DET
Thu, Aug 15th   @ DET
Fri, Aug 16th@ TB@ PIT
Sat, Aug 17th@ TB@ PIT
Sun, Aug 18th@ TB@ PIT
Mon, Aug 19th@ MIA@ LAD
Tue, Aug 20th@ MIA@ LAD
Wed, Aug 21st@ MIA@ LAD
Fri, Aug 23rd@ BOSvs SF
Sat, Aug 24th@ BOSvs SF
Sun, Aug 25th@ BOSvs SF
Mon, Aug 26th   vs TB
Tue, Aug 27thvs NYMvs TB
Wed, Aug 28thvs NYMvs TB
Fri, Aug 30thvs LAD@ LAA
Sat, Aug 31stvs LAD@ LAA
Sun, Sep 1stvs LAD@ LAA
Mon, Sep 2ndvs LAD@ OAK
Tue, Sep 3rd@ SF@ OAK
Wed, Sep 4th@ SF@ OAK
Thu, Sep 5th@ SF@ OAK
Fri, Sep 6th@ HOU@ STL
Sat, Sep 7th@ HOU@ STL
Sun, Sep 8th@ HOU@ STL
Tue, Sep 10thvs TEXvs SD
Wed, Sep 11thvs TEXvs SD
Thu, Sep 12th   vs TEX
Fri, Sep 13thvs MILvs TEX
Sat, Sep 14thvs MILvs TEX
Sun, Sep 15thvs MILvs TEX
Tue, Sep 17th@ COLvs NYY
Wed, Sep 18th@ COLvs NYY
Thu, Sep 19th@ MILvs NYY
Fri, Sep 20th@ MIL@ TEX
Sat, Sep 21st@ MIL@ TEX
Sun, Sep 22nd@ MIL@ TEX
Mon, Sep 23rdvs SF@ HOU
Tue, Sep 24thvs SF@ HOU
Wed, Sep 25thvs SF@ HOU
Fri, Sep 27thvs SDvs OAK
Sat, Sep 28thvs SDvs OAK
Sun, Sep 29thvs SDvs OAK
Thu, Apr 18th@ SFLogan Webb (1-1)#9   
Mon, Apr 22nd@ STLLance Lynn (1-0)#67   
Mon, Jun 3rdvs SF   
Thu, Jun 27thvs MIN   
Mon, Jul 8thvs ATL   
Mon, Aug 5th@ CLE   
Mon, Aug 12thvs COL   
Thu, Aug 29thvs NYM   
Mon, Sep 16th@ COL